Material information:
- Chipboard: Chipboard is a composite wood material made from small pieces of wood, usually pine or fir, bonded together under high pressure and temperature using resins. It is widely used in furniture construction, interior surfaces, and structural applications. Made from recycled materials, it is resistant to warping, abrasions, and other physical stresses.
- Melamine (LPB): Low Pressure Melamine (LPB) is a synthetic material widely used in the surface treatment of chipboard in furniture and surfaces due to its durability and ease of maintenance. It is applied to substrates like MDF or OSB plywood to create durable surfaces.
Material maintenance:
- Chipboard: For cleaning chipboard, use a soft cloth slightly dampened with water and mild detergent. Avoid excessive water and keep the surface dry after cleaning.
- Melamine (LPB): Melamine is one of the most commonly used materials in furniture. To remove stains from the surface, use a soft cloth with lukewarm water and mild soap. Gently wipe the surface until the stain is removed. Melamine is sensitive to moisture, so it is important to protect it from water.
